Legal Status

The propagation and practice of the various systems of alternative medicine is absolutely legal and in accordance with the constitution of India under Article 19(1)/(g).

Successful and Trained Student of this Council can Practice and profess the various systems of Alternative Medicines. Registration/Permission from Medical Council of India (MCI) is not required to practice Alternative System of Medicines as per their letter no. MCI-34(1)/96-MED/10984.

“No Harassment to Alternative Medical Practitioners”

Hon’ble Supreme Court of India

Contents of the Judgment of Hon’ble Supreme Court of India Dated : 24.11.2000
(In the Judgment and Order Date 18.11.1998 in F.A.O. No. 205/92)
For want of certain clarification etc. Delhi Govt. & Union of India (Ministry of Health & F.W.) Has filed an appeal (SLP) in the Hon’ble Supreme Court of India challenging the order of Hon’ble Delhi High Court Dt. 18.11.1998. upon hearing on 12.11.2000 the Division Bench of Hon’ble Justice R.C. Lahoti & Hon’ble Justice Shivraj V. Patil has rejected the plea of Delhi Govt. & Union of India and finally on 24.11.2000 the bench of the Hon’ble court Comprising Justice Rajendra Babu and B.N. Agarwal has declined to entertain the matter and SLP filed by petitioner (Delhi Govt. & Union of India) has been dismissed. The Hon’ble Supreme court of India also maintained that status quo of the order of Hon’ble Delhi High Court (FAO No. 205/92) Dt. 18.11.1998 by which it has been ordered that any legally constituted institution imparting Educational facilities in the filed a Alternative Medicines may issue Diploma/Certficate and holders of such Diploma/Certficate are entitled to practice the particular Faculty/Faculties covered by the said Diploma/Cetificates.

According to the Judgment of High Court Chenni, Planning Commission Report & The letter of Govt. (No. 110/8/4/77MPT/ME(P)1979 & No 4-6/70 MPT of Govt. of India) The AM certificate Holder can practice in alternative medicine only. He can’t practice in Surgery, Obstetrics & Radiation Therapy in any form. He can not prescribed any medicine includes ‘G’, ‘H’ & ‘L’ of Drugs & Cosmetic Rules 1945 and other Dangers Drug at any cost.
